Saturday, September 29, 1928 was the rescheduled date for the first Wakefield Cup contest held since 1914. The original date had been set for Sunday, September 2, 1928. Martin Sonka has won the 2018 Red Bull Air Race World Championship following a nail-biting final race in Fort Worth, Texas.
